An intimate evening of original americana from British/American duo A Different Thread with support from Hudson Valley's own Little Sister.A Different Thread:

Some things are just meant to be. Alicia Best (US) and Robert Jackson (UK) met while busking on the cobbled streets of Ireland and discovered both a musical and personal harmony that was serendipitous. In the decade since forming A Different Thread, Best and Jackson have taken their act on the road, touring over a dozen countries, supporting artists such as Milk Carton Kids and Jody Stephens (Big Star), and garnering critical praise from the likes of Folk Radio UK, which hailed the duo as “warm, deep songwriters that have drank from the well of 20th century tradition.”
Their sound is transcontinental, blending Jackson's British folk rock background with Best's North Carolina-bred alt-country melodies. Informed by their life experiences (navigating visas, vanlife, love across oceans) and liberal commentary on both environmental and social justice topics. While inspired by artists like Gillian Welch, The Avett Brothers, and John Prine, A Different Thread maintain a distinct sound that is all their own.
Little Sister:

We are Little Sister, a New Paltz based indie rock band with a folk twist, bringing banjo, electric guitar, and keys to intimate rooms and community stages. Our set list ranges from brooding, original indie rock music to resonant and hopeful folk and can be adjusted for large stages or more acoustic, for intimate venues.
Originally a joint project between songwriter and vocalist Laura Westman and multi instrumentalist Neil Curri, Little Sister evolved after Laura and Neil were invited to play Rosendale Street Festival in 2025. Since then, we've grown our repertoire, playing Slice of New Pulse in New Paltz, and have an upcoming self-produced showcase on February 17. Dave Runski of Highland is our percussionist and Justin Reilly plays bass and banjo. They bring so much personality and depth to the music. It is a joy to play together.
